A tennis player swings her 1100 gram racket with a speed of 11 meter per second. She hits a 60 gram tennis ball that was approaching her at 20 meter per second. The ball rebounds at 38 m/s

a. Obtain how fast is her racket moving immediately after the impact?

(in m/s)

You can neglect the interaction of the racket with her hand for the brief duration of the collision.

b. If the tennis ball and racket are in contact for 11 milliseconds, find the average force that racket exerts on ball?
